ABB M102 Series: Comprehensive Module Range and Technical Overview

The ABB M102 series is a dedicated line of motor management and protection relay modules engineered for continuous-duty industrial environments. Deployed extensively across global heavy industry — including petrochemical complexes, nuclear auxiliary systems, offshore platforms, and refinery motor control centers (MCCs) — the M102 platform provides standardized, DIN-rail-compatible protection and I/O expansion for low-voltage motor feeders rated up to 690 V AC. Its modular architecture allows plant engineers to configure protection, monitoring, and communication functions independently, reducing spare parts inventory complexity and enabling targeted replacement without full relay changeout.

The series integrates directly with ABB's System pro M compact and MNS switchgear families, and is compatible with PROFIBUS-DP and Modbus RTU fieldbus architectures, making it a long-standing fixture in distributed control system (DCS) and SCADA-linked motor management schemes.

The Evolution of M102 Architecture

The M102 platform was introduced as ABB's response to the industry demand for modular, field-replaceable motor protection at the feeder level. Early variants focused on thermal overload and phase-loss detection with analog output signaling. Subsequent generations added digital I/O expansion modules (the -P and -T suffixes), enabling integration with PLC-based control systems without requiring dedicated protection relays per feeder.

The introduction of communication-capable variants (PROFIBUS, Modbus) marked the transition from standalone relay logic to networked motor management, allowing condition data — run hours, trip counts, thermal state — to be aggregated at the DCS level. Later revisions addressed IEC 60947-4-1 compliance updates and added ground-fault detection capability.

Compatibility note: M102 modules use a proprietary backplane connector. Cross-generation substitution requires verification of firmware revision and terminal block pinout. Modules from pre-2005 production runs may require adapter kits when replacing with current-production equivalents.

M102 Full Catalog & Functionalities (SKU List)

The following SKUs represent the verified M102 series module range. Each entry is classified by functional category.

Input/Output Modules

  • M102-P: Digital I/O expansion module; 4DI / 2DO for motor control interfacing
  • M102-T: Thermistor input module; PTC/NTC motor winding temperature monitoring
  • M102-M: Analog output module; 4–20 mA current loop signal for thermal load value

Base Protection Relay Units

  • M101-P: Base motor protection relay; thermal overload, phase loss, phase imbalance
  • M101-T: Base relay with integrated thermistor input; single-channel PTC
  • M101-M: Base relay with analog output; 4–20 mA thermal load signal output

Communication Adapter Modules

  • M102-DP: PROFIBUS-DP communication adapter for M101/M102 base units
  • M102-MB: Modbus RTU communication adapter; RS-485 interface, 9.6–115.2 kbps
  • M102-DN: DeviceNet communication adapter; CAN-based, 125–500 kbps

Power Supply & Auxiliary Modules

  • M102-PS24: 24 V DC auxiliary power supply module for M102 bus rail
  • M102-PS110: 110 V AC/DC auxiliary power supply module
  • M102-PS230: 230 V AC auxiliary power supply module

Expansion & Specialty Modules

  • M102-GF: Ground fault detection module; residual current monitoring, 0.3–30 A range
  • M102-V: Voltage monitoring module; under/overvoltage detection on 3-phase supply
  • M102-C: Current measurement module; true RMS current monitoring per phase
  • M102-EX: ATEX-rated isolation module for hazardous area motor feeders (Zone 2)

Quality Control for the M102 Range

M102 modules present specific test challenges due to their backplane bus communication architecture and mixed analog/digital signal paths. DriveKNMS applies the following test protocol to all M102 units prior to dispatch:

  • Backplane bus integrity check: Verification of M-Bus communication between base relay and expansion modules using ABB-compatible test jig
  • Digital I/O functional test: All DI channels verified for threshold response; DO relay contacts tested for switching capacity and contact resistance (<100 mΩ)
  • Thermistor input calibration: PTC/NTC response curve verified against ABB specification table for M102-T units
  • Communication adapter handshake test: PROFIBUS-DP and Modbus adapters tested for correct GSD/device profile response using protocol analyzer
  • Analog output linearity: 4–20 mA output verified at 0%, 25%, 50%, 75%, 100% thermal load simulation points
  • Dielectric withstand: 500 V DC insulation resistance test across all isolated signal paths
  • Visual and mechanical inspection: Connector pins, DIN rail clip, and module locking tabs inspected; conformal coating integrity checked under UV light
